What is a Tungsten Cube?
A tungsten cube is a solid block made from pure tungsten, one of the densest naturally occurring metals on Earth. With a density of 19.3 g/cm³, tungsten is nearly as dense as gold and more than twice as dense as steel—making even a small cube surprisingly heavy.

Key Properties & Why Tungsten Cubes Stand Out
Tungsten is one of the densest naturally occurring metals on the planet, with a density of 19.25 g/cm³. That means even small cubes feel surprisingly heavy. Key properties include:
- Extreme density — ideal for physics and material science experiments
- High melting point (3422°C) — makes it resistant to heat
- Corrosion resistance — perfect for long-lasting educational or decorative use
- Smooth, polished finish — aesthetically appealing for collectors
These attributes make tungsten cubes versatile for desk display, lab measurements, and educational demonstrations.

Tungsten Cube Size & Weight Comparison — Quick Overview
The chart below shows the approximate weights of tungsten cubes of different sizes, based on pure tungsten’s density of 19.3 g/cm³.
| Size (mm) | 99.95% W weight (kg) | 97% W weight (kg) | 95% W weight (kg) | 93% W weight (kg) | 90% W weight (kg) |
| 10*10*10 | 0.019 | 0.019 | 0.01848 | 0.01797 | 0.01745 |
| 12.7*12.7*12.7 | 0.039 | 0.038 | 0.03697 | 0.03594 | 0.03491 |
| 25.4*25.4*25.4 | 0.315 | 0.303 | 0.2948 | 0.2866 | 0.2784 |
| 38.1*38.1*38.1 | 1.06 | 1.02 | 0.9924 | 0.9648 | 0.9372 |
| 50.8*50.8*50.8 | 2.51 | 2.42 | 2.3545 | 2.2891 | 2.2237 |
| 63.5*63.5*63.5 | 4.91 | 4.73 | 4.6021 | 4.4743 | 4.3464 |
| 76.2*76.2*76.2 | 8.49 | 8.19 | 7.9686 | 7.7472 | 7.5259 |
| 101.6*101.6*101.6 | 20.13 | 19.4 | 18.8756 | 18.3513 | 17.827 |

Tungsten Cubes: Handling and Safety Considerations
Because of their significant mass, tungsten cubes should be handled carefully to prevent damage or injury. Here are some best practices for safe laboratory and educational handling:
1. Handle with Care
Even a 2 inch tungsten cube weight can cause damage if dropped. Always hold cubes securely and use stable, non-slip surfaces.
2. Use Protective Equipment
Wear gloves when handling to maintain grip and prevent fingerprints on polished surfaces.
3. Store Safely
Keep tungsten metal cubes on strong shelves or in padded boxes. Avoid glass or delicate surfaces, which may crack under the weight.
4. Demonstrate Density Visually
Compare a 1 inch cube of tungsten weight with a same-sized aluminum or steel cube to vividly show students the difference in density.
5. Avoid Scratches and Impacts
Although tungsten is extremely hard, its polished finish can be scratched. Handle with soft cloths and store separately from other metals.
